INCITE NEWSLIFE SCIENCE INVESTORS GET THEIR DUEInvesting in life science products from biotechnology to diagnostic products can mean high risk and long waits for investors wanting ten times their initial investment. Most venture capital investors seek the crystal balls of freshly minted MBAs and discussions with scientists and physicians for insights about new medical technologies. However, the investment wildcards include unanticipated regulatory delays and competitive product offerings from unknown sources that require experienced functional experts to evaluate. Without this experienced input, life science investors prefer a conservative approach to investments and are currently funding companies and products with features similar to existing fare. So, how do innovative products get out of the lab and into the market?
